Partager via


Interface IPortWavePciStream (portcls.h)

L’interface IPortWavePciStream est l’interface de rappel associée au flux qui fournit des services de mappage aux objets de flux miniport WavePci. Le pilote de port WavePci implémente cette interface et l’expose au pilote miniport. Le pilote de port fournit une référence à un objet IPortWavePciStream à chaque objet de flux miniport qu’il crée. IPortWavePciStream hérite de l’interface IUnknown.

Le flux est associé à une broche sur le filtre WavePci, que le pilote de l’adaptateur forme en liant le port et les pilotes miniport. Le pilote de port appelle la méthode IMiniportWavePci ::NewStream pour créer l’objet de flux miniport ; le pilote de port transmet une référence IPortWavePciStream comme l’un des paramètres d’appel.

Héritage

L’interface IPortWavePciStream hérite de l’interface IUnknown.

Méthode

L’interface IPortWavePciStream a ces méthodes.

 
IPortWavePciStream ::GetMapping

La méthode GetMapping obtient un mappage à partir du pilote de port et associe une balise au mappage.
IPortWavePciStream ::ReleaseMapping

La méthode ReleaseMapping libère un mappage obtenu par un appel précédent à IPortWavePciStream ::GetMapping.
IPortWavePciStream ::TerminatePacket

La méthode TerminatePacket met fin au paquet actuellement mappé.

Exigences

Exigence Valeur
plateforme cible Windows
d’en-tête portcls.h